Piecha introduces the Mercedes SL Avalange GT-R

by SpeedLux

Following a preview earlier this year, JMS and Piecha have unveiled their Avalange GT-R body kit for the Mercedes SL.

Starting up front, the convertible has been equipped with a replacement front bumper (€3570) that options “air blades” and integrated led daytime running lights. The automobile conjointly features a 25mm reduced ride height (€499) and aerodynamic facet skirts (€2090) which may be equipped with optional led lights (€298).

Moving additional back, there is a aerated rear bumper (€2975) with an aggressive diffuser that is flanked by trapezoidal exhaust tips (€573). there is conjointly a decklid spoiler (€785) that guarantees to assist keep the automobile planted at speed.

Customers can even order 20-inch alloy wheels (€3190) as well as 12-piece fin set in high gloss black, shadow graphite matte and “Galvanosilber.”
